The “Outmanned” buff in WvW now grants you immunity to armor damage, so if you die, you have no repair bill. This change is right up there with the end of culling and improved FPS as a WvW improvement.
I have always believed that death penalties in WvW ruin the experience for everyone as most people will not fight to the death if likely to lose, but instead choose to wp out at the last minute to avoid repair bills. This makes capturing keeps a boring routine of fighting NPC guards and then grinding a gate down…what some people are calling “PVD” or “Player vs Door.”
It also discourages cost sensitive players from participating, as it can be very demoralizing on a low pop server to constantly get killed by massive zergs and have nothing to show for it but a repair bill.
What I am seeing now is that players are willing to fight to the death to hold a keep, as they don’t have to worry about a repair bill (so long as they have that buff) and some of the fights for keeps have become extremely intense and FUN as a result.
Not only are outnumbered groups fighting to hold keeps they would normally wp out of, but they are actually winning and wiping the attackers. I have rarely seen this on my server because people so rarely stand and fight to the death. Now there is no reason not to fight to the death, as you just wp out when its over in either case…if you lose.
I hope Anet will realize they knocked it out of the park with this change and eliminate death penalties in WvW for good. They do not help in any way and only discourage the kind of risk-taking, aggressive play that is the norm in non-death penalty games.

The easiest way to control the hyperinflation in this game is with price caps. There is no need for instituting mechanics that clearly do now work to control inflation and which only cause players frustration.
There is currently a price floor on items, in that you cannot sell items on the TP for less than a vendor will pay for them ( though you can still take a loss over selling to a vendor due to the exorbitant TP fees). You can create a similar system for most items where they cannot sell for more than 5 times the vendor price, or just set a fixed maximum price for the item, and leave sellers to compete in the gap between minimum and maximum prices.
With inflation thus controlled, you can then proceed to eliminate wp costs, repair blls, DR and the other anti-player mechanisms and taxes this game is bogged down.
